What are the responsibilities of a vice president in Colombia?

The Vice President of Colombia is the second-highest executive official in the country, acting as the immediate successor to the President in case of absence, resignation, or incapacity. The Vice President also undertakes specific duties delegated by the President, which may include representing the government in official events, overseeing certain national programs, or leading special governmental initiatives. Additionally, the Vice President often plays a role in international diplomacy and supports the government's legislative agenda. However, the Vice President does not have any independent executive powers unless assigned by the President or required by law.

Job Description:

This individual will be responsible for helping coordinate the day-to-day execution of all RCM functions, working with the Chief Revenue Officer ("CRO") and the other RCM Vice Presidents to optimize performance, ensure proactive communication with practices, manage risks and issues along with the overall OO RCM team. This role will also work with the CRO to manage the operational infrastructure within RCM to support continued growth through practice

acquisition and integration. In addition, this individual will drive development, production and communication of KPI's and metrics usage across the RCM platform.

Responsibilities:

Operational Leadership

  • Work closely with the CRO and the other RCM VP's to coordinate delivery of high-quality RCM services to practices including timely and proactive communication to practice leadership.

  • Develop, monitor, improve and communicate KPIs such as days in A/R, day sales outstanding (DSO's), clean claim rate, denial rate, and cash collections; develop dashboards and reporting cadence for executive visibility.

  • Embed the KPI's into everyday RCM operations such that each RCM team assesses performance based on these KPI's.

  • Develop action plans and work alongside the other RCM VP's to constantly drive down DSO's, improve collections, coordinate RCM responses to external, macro-economic challenges such as vendor issues, government actions, or payor actions.

  • Coordinate internal RCM team operations - including leading planning for and leading leadership meetings, managing risk and issues log.

  • With the CRO, coordinate the various end-to-end revenue cycle operations including patient access, prior authorization, coding, charge capture, billing, A/R follow-up, denial management, and payment posting.

  • Oversee specialty-specific workflows such as:

    • Oncology: Infusion and drug billing (e.g., J-codes, NDC mapping), prior

    • authorization for high-cost therapies, Medicare Part B compliance.

    • Urology: Procedure bundling, surgical authorization, and device billing.

    • Surgery: Global periods, modifier usage, inpatient/outpatient billing distinctions.

  • Develop and maintain a proactive approach for RCM to stay ahead of issues or risks before they impact practice or OneOncology operations.

  • Ensure timely communication and coordination with other internal OneOncology teams such as Operational Regional Leadership, Accounting, Revenue Recognition, FP&A and the Executive Team of OneOncology.
